The BLAVOR Solar Power Bank is a compact 10,000mAh portable charger featuring 20W USB-C fast charging, solar panel recharging, and the ability to charge three devices simultaneously. Designed with durable, waterproof materials and equipped with dual flashlights and a compass carabiner, it’s the ultimate power solution for professionals and outdoor enthusiasts who demand reliable energy on the go.

Great battery pack
This battery I think is great to have if you are constantly hiking or out and about. I will say this do NOT just leave this in the sun say in your car or by a window. Regardless if the solar charging, it is still a battery and you may not want the battery to get super hot or it can cause damage. The solar part it does charge but I cannot expect it to charge to full. It is definitely great to have if you are hiking and just need a little extra power. There is a solar light indicator as shown on the picture that is a green light. It is a bit water resistant but it is definitely not something you want to drop into the water. It does have a type C plug that you can use to charge the device. The USB ports as well as the wireless does not support fast charging. The wireless charging from what I can tell works with most cases which is good and the USB ports are covered by a silicone cover if you happen to be walking through the rain. Again it is water resistant but not water proof. There is a nice hook you can use to hook to your backpack or belt so it may be in direct sunlight and get charging. Be aware that any light will cause the charging light to turn on. The hook does come with a compass which can easily be screwed up by any magnet so use with caution. The wireless charging pad does have rubber stoppers to keep the device from sliding off of it. The overall charge time will vary based on whether you are using your phone or the number of devices. It can charge up to three devices (one needing to be via wireless). I would say on average it can charge most phone within three hours with no use. There are rubber protection on the side so if you happen to drop it from a small distant the battery will be fine. The battery does get warm when it is in use so make sure you take precautions if you are using this in your pocket. The flash light has duel lightning which is still a bit weak sadly than most other LED battery backs that I have seen. It does give a good lighting but I feel with one light you get better performance. The type C cable that comes with the battery is fairly long but a bit cheap for my liking but I just use my own. Overall I think this device is a great thing to have if you are on the go a lot. It is resilient and pretty good amount of battery to keep your devices charged.
